Before calling up the removalists Brisbane based when preparing to move, many people realise that it is in their best interests to clean out their houses of the things they will not need at their eventual destination. As such, they wind up going through a lot of closets and drawers, finding things that Brisbane removalists need not waste their time loading onto a truck and transporting down the road. Yet while it can be simple to throw such things away without a thought, there are people who could really use all that stuff that you simply see as junk. A few items in particular can be reused to the benefit of others.It can be very tempting to simply call furniture removalists in QLD to load up all the chairs and tables found throughout your home, but let's face it - you don't really want most of them anyway. Furniture is one of the most sought-after items at donation centres, and setting such things aside for those who really need them can be a positive step you can take while moving. There is no reason to make furniture removalists in QLD load up your old, ragged couch to take to your new home. Instead, consider giving it to someone who can look past the minor tear in the cushion and find a place for it in their own house.Clothes are another frequently needed item that you probably have plenty to share. In some areas where the temperature can get quite low getting warm clothing to those with fewer resources can go a long way in improving their quality of life. If you find that when you open your closet doors you are staring back at a bunch of articles of clothing you rarely wear, give many of them away.
